OuA Dttbbdfo DaxUmS The Royal girls were well on their way to an eight- five season in this game against Augusta. In this, their first game of the 1974-75 season, our ladies of the court gave the sur- prised Augusta squad a very sound trouncing winning quite handily. Susan Hick- erson got the tip, and it was all ours from then on, thanks to fancy ball han- dling as shown here by Barb Landers. Coach Mahan nearly lost her scalp as she gave her all in a fine job of coaching, and the winning Royals went to the dressing room tired but happy. 16

FM The Mason County FHA Chapter was busy all year with their many activities and community functions. To start the year, they held many money making projects including a tractor pull, candy and bake sales, and the annual candy bar sale. These projects increased the budget to handle the social events. Dads loved Daddy Date Night, and the dances - Hallow- een, Christmas and Valentines - proved to be fun and suc- cessful. Mrs. Ann Porter, the chapter advisor, kept the chap- ter strong with her guidance and support. This year she also advised the Regional President and, the Regional Reporter. The community depends on the FHA to hold such drives as the March of Dimes, Arthritis Fund, and the Heart Fund. All girls enjoyed writing Santa letters to local children. The Governor's visit allowed several girls to participate as aides. A dinner for the Needy Kids was given with the help of several of our members. Senior FHA Officers This year, the Mason County chapter was an Honor Roll chapter which is quite an honor. Finally, the Mother-Daugh- ter banquet closed the year with awards of achievement and installation of incoming officers. 18 Mason County FHA Chapter members
